On a recent trip to Cape May, in the aftermath of a once in a lifetime snow storm, I stayed for three days at the charming and stately Abigail Adams. Eschewing my usual motel choices, I wanted to be right in the heart of the Historic District. Frankly, didn't know what to expect of a private apartment, and was really pleasantly surprised. All the amenities were first rate, a Queen size comfortable bed in a well appointed bedroom, beautiful restored bathroom with Victorian style fixtures and tiling, a decently sized eat in kitchen overlooking the charming snow covered gardens in the rear. It even has a private entrance just off of tree lined and gas lit Decatur Street. Though its called an apartment,, it is more like staying in a large private one bedroom suite in an upscale historic inn. This would be a great place to stay in the summer for a vacation in Cape May, as the beach is less than a block away, and great restaurants and theater are just a short stroll across the pedestrian mall.
